6 Essential Plumbing Checks for New Homeowners
For new house owners, understanding and keeping bathroom plumbing can save both money and time by protecting against costly problems down the line. Right here are some crucial bathroom pipes tips to help you keep whatever running efficiently.

Acquaint Yourself with the Key Shut-Off Shutoff


Recognizing where the major water shut-off valve is located in your home is crucial. This permits you to quickly switch off the supply of water in case of significant leakages or throughout plumbing emergencies, protecting against substantial water damages.

Regularly Examine for Leaks


Little leaks can bring about large issues. On a regular basis examine under sinks, around toilets, and near pipes fixtures for any indicators of leaks. Try to find dampness, small drips, or rust. Capturing and repairing leaks early can prevent a lot more severe damage and conserve water.

Do Not Neglect Slow Drains


If your sink or bath tub is draining pipes gradually, it's commonly a sign of an obstruction developing. Addressing this very early can stop a full clog. Utilize a plunger or a plumber's serpent to remove particles. Prevent using chemical drain cleaners as they can harm your pipelines with time.

Know What Not to Flush


Toilets are not waste disposal unit. Prevent flushing anything aside from toilet paper and human waste. Products like wipes, womanly health products, and cotton swabs ought to be dealt with in the garbage to avoid blockages and drain backups.

Set Up Strainers in Drains


Location filters in your sink and bathtub drains to capture hair and various other particles prior to they enter your plumbing system. Cleansing the filters consistently will assist protect against build-up and keep water streaming openly.

Keep Your Hot Water Heater


Ensure your hot water heater is readied to a proper temperature level (usually around 120 degrees Fahrenheit) to avoid hot and reduce energy use. Flush the container each year to get rid of sediment accumulation, which can reduce the effectiveness and life-span of your heating system.

Update Your Components


If your home has older fixtures, consider updating to much more effective versions. Modern toilets, showerheads, and taps are made to utilize less water while supplying good stress, which can substantially minimize your water costs and ecological footprint.

Be Cautious with Do It Yourself Plumbing Repair Works


While it's appealing to take care of all home repairs on your own, be cautious with plumbing. Some issues may call for specialist know-how, especially if they involve main water lines or sewage system repair services. Working with a professional can in some cases be a lot more cost-efficient than DIY, particularly if it stops more damage.

Get Ready For Winter


Secure your pipes from freezing during winter by shielding pipes in unheated locations like basements, attic rooms, and garages. Throughout severe cool, allow cold water drip from faucets served by exposed pipes to assist prevent cold.

Schedule Routine Maintenance


Think about organizing annual inspections with a licensed plumbing technician. They can identify problems that you could miss, such as hidden leaks or deterioration on pipes and components. Regular maintenance helps extend the life of your pipes system and can protect against emergency situations.

Verdict


Comprehending and maintaining your home's restroom plumbing can protect against several usual problems. By adhering to these essential tips, you can guarantee your bathroom stays functional and reliable, saving you time and money over time.

Essential Plumbing Tips for Homeowners: Keep Your Pipes Flowing Smoothly


As a homeowner, understanding the basics of your plumbing system can save you time, money, and a lot of headaches. Plumbing issues can range from minor annoyances like dripping faucets to major problems like burst pipes that cause significant damage. This guide provides essential tips to help you maintain your plumbing system and tackle common issues.



Understanding Your Plumbing System


  • Supply System: Brings fresh water into your home from a municipal source or a well.


  • Drain-Waste-Vent System: Removes wastewater and vents sewer gases outside.


  • Fixtures and Appliances: Includes sinks, toilets, showers, dishwashers, and washing machines.


  • Basic Maintenance Tips


  • Regular Inspections: Periodically check for leaks, corrosion, and other signs of wear and tear. Look under sinks, around toilets, and near water heaters.


  • Know Your Main Shut-Off Valve: In case of a major leak, you’ll need to shut off the water quickly. Ensure everyone in your household knows where the main shut-off valve is located.


  • Prevent Frozen Pipes: In cold climates, insulate exposed pipes and let faucets drip during extreme cold to prevent freezing.


  • Use Strainers: Install strainers in sinks and tubs to catch hair, food particles, and other debris that can cause clogs.


  • Common Plumbing Issues and Solutions


    Clogged Drains:


  • Prevention: Avoid pouring grease down the drain and use drain screens to catch debris.


  • DIY Fix: Use a plunger or a plumbing snake to clear minor clogs. For stubborn clogs, a mixture of baking soda and vinegar can sometimes help.

  • Leaky Faucets:


  • Prevention: Replace washers and seals regularly.


  • DIY Fix: Turn off the water supply, disassemble the faucet, and replace worn parts.
